Every platform developed within the eco619 ecosystem is guided by a disciplined set of engineering principles:
- Architecture Before Interface — Solve engineering problems before designing user experiences.
- Evidence Invariance — Preserve original identity and immutable source records.
- Separated Lineage — Every derivative maintains traceable parent relationships.
- Horizontal Autonomy — Zero hardcoded paths. Zero environment assumptions.
- Thread Isolation — Worker failures never compromise platform stability.
- Verification Separation — Extraction does not equal verification.

| Repository | Primary Responsibility | Technical Maturity |
|---|---|---|
| ai-document-library | Autonomous document intelligence platform, six-layer runtime implementation, artifact lifecycle management, orchestration services, and platform architecture. | Active Integration |
| engineering-docs | Engineering standards, Architectural Decision Records (ADRs), schemas, technical specifications, data contracts, and cross-platform design references. | Implemented |
| .github | Organization profile, shared repository standards, contribution guidelines, and common GitHub configuration. | Implemented |
